A Tippecanoe Valley high school student has died, one day after she was hit by another student on a bicycle.
Seventeen-year-old Evelyn Bolen was in gym class Tuesday when she was accidentally hit by a boy who was riding the gym teacher's bike.
Bolen was a special needs student.
Her cause of death has not been released.
Extra counselors are on hand to help students deal with the tragedy.
